Transaction e8569d78a8e1607466cc87cbbf2c23bcfb0c4a87f58eeef2528a713b5174c594
1 Input
1 Output
-
e8569d78a8e1607466cc87cbbf2c23bcfb0c4a87f58eeef2528a713b5174c594:0
- value
- 43046415
- script pubkey
- OP_0 OP_PUSHBYTES_20 0d68139013d2f22ef334a902aba2b5f0a8c96723
- address
- bc1qp45p8yqn6tezaue54yp2hg447z5vjeerlerz3q